Here is my Sahara half way through a 1400km drive to the Bay of Fundy with my Kayaks. I have a Congo Cage with Yakima rollers. The only complaint that I have is the wind noise is a killer on the highway. I ended up wearing my noise canceling headphones on the way home.

I bought the TJ sport cage rack from quadratec. It is a yakima rack that I had to modify it's setup. The JK roll bar is too wide in diameter for this rack to fit correctly ontop so this is what I did.
On the back cross bar, you need to unzip the rollcage pad and attach the clamps onto the smaller tube inside, under the padding. On the front, you need to take out the plastic channels above the front doors, and the mounts have to be turned around so they don't hang out of the jeep, rather sit inside the roll cage.
It worked really well without any cutting, drilling or changes to either the rackk or the truck. This is a fair weather rack so it has to come off for the top to go back up.
